8h
Creators on MSNThree Tiers of BelizeBy Lesley Frederikson From the top of El Castillo, the tallest Mayan ruin at Xunantunich and second-largest man-made ...
Introduction When it comes to offshore incorporations, two names often come to mind—Belize and the British Virgin Islands 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results